In the world of high-speed file transfers and server-side downloading, has long been the go-to script for users looking to bypass the limitations of local internet speeds. Among its many iterations, Rapidleech v2 Rev 43 (Verified) stands out as one of the most stable and trusted versions ever released.

RapidLeech is a popular, open-source, and free PHP-based download accelerator and leeching script. It allows users to download files from various hosting services, including RapidShare, MegaUpload, and more.
